Before they are able to be utilized, clay chimineas need to be properly dried. This means increasing the temperature gradually over several small fires. To avoid moisture damage the chimineas should be under cover or away from rainy conditions. Buyers can shield their chiminea from winter storms by using a stack of metal cover or placing the sand or rock in the base of the unit. The sand and rock will stop the chiminea's temperature from rising too much which can cause it to crack.
Chimineas don't have dampers like stoves and fireplaces, which control the burning process, therefore it is essential to keep them away from fire-prone surfaces. Also, the open design of a ceramic chiminea makes it an encroachment on fire that should not be brought inside a house unlike regular steel and cast iron fireplaces with flame-resistant designs and sealed doors.
Since a chiminea functions as an outdoor stove, it must be kept away from flammable materials and at least six feet away from nearest structure, such as fences or structures. The chiminea's surfaces can become hot enough to burn skin and should be avoided by children and dogs. A chimenea guard will keep pets and children away from the hot surface, and a log screen will keep sparks and spit off of the top of the stack. It's important to use only seasoned wood and stoke the fire carefully to reduce sparking.
